More about No14 Lovel St

No14 Lovel St

Located in the centre of the Blue Mountains, No.14 Lovel St is just 500 metres from Katoomba train station.

Solo traveller

Comment: 13 Feb 2025

Stayed in: Feb 2025

Delightful place to stay and excellent value

No 14 is a simply delightful place to stay. It’s perfect for solo travellers who would like convivial company as well as the privacy of their own room. The house is extremely comfortable with a very pleasant outside seating area. The owners have put a lot of thought into organising the kitchen etc and got struck a good balance between communicating what the arrangements are without over complicating it. Excellent location - it is within walking distance of the station. Very good value
